Ejector Pump Installation in Providence, RI
Ejector pump installation services provide a practical solution for homeowners dealing with basement or underground level plumbing challenges, especially when traditional gravity drainage isn't sufficient. These systems are designed to pump wastewater from areas below the main sewer line, making them suitable for projects such as finishing a basement, adding a bathroom, or managing sump and sewage ejector needs. Property owners typically want to understand how an ejector pump works, where it should be installed, and what type of unit best suits their property's plumbing layout to ensure proper function and long-term reliability.
Before requesting ejector pump installation, property owners should consider the specific requirements of their plumbing system, including the size and capacity of the pump needed for their household or project. It's also important to understand the location of existing sewer lines, the electrical needs of the system, and any potential space constraints. Proper installation ensures effective removal of wastewater and helps prevent issues like backups or odors, making it a key consideration for maintaining a functional and sanitary basement or lower-level space.

Ejector Pump Installation Questions
What is an ejector pump used for? An ejector pump helps remove wastewater from below-grade areas, such as basements or crawl spaces, when gravity drainage isn't possible.
When should property owners consider ejector pump installation? Installation is recommended when plumbing fixtures are located below the main sewer line or in areas prone to drainage issues.
What are common projects involving ejector pumps? Typical projects include basement bathroom installations, sump pump systems, and converting below-grade spaces into living areas.
What should be checked before installing an ejector pump? It's important to assess the property's plumbing system, space for the unit, and proper venting to ensure effective operation.
